Class ServiceConfig


  • public class ServiceConfig
    extends java.lang.Object
    Configuration for a single service.
    • Constructor Detail

      • ServiceConfig

        public ServiceConfig()
    • Method Detail

      • isEnabled

        public boolean isEnabled()
      • setEnabled

        public ServiceConfig setEnabled​(boolean enabled)
      • getName

        public java.lang.String getName()
      • setName

        public ServiceConfig setName​(java.lang.String name)
      • getClassName

        public java.lang.String getClassName()
      • setClassName

        public ServiceConfig setClassName​(java.lang.String className)
      • getImplementation

        public java.lang.Object getImplementation()
        Since:
        3.7
      • setImplementation

        public ServiceConfig setImplementation​(java.lang.Object serviceImpl)
        Since:
        3.7
      • getProperties

        public java.util.Properties getProperties()
      • setProperties

        public ServiceConfig setProperties​(java.util.Properties properties)
      • addProperty

        public ServiceConfig addProperty​(java.lang.String propertyName,
                                         java.lang.String value)
      • setConfigObject

        public ServiceConfig setConfigObject​(java.lang.Object configObject)
      • getConfigObject

        public java.lang.Object getConfigObject()
      • equals

        public final boolean equals​(java.lang.Object o)
        Overrides:
        equals in class java.lang.Object
      • hashCode

        public final int hashCode()
        Overrides:
        hashCode in class java.lang.Object
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object